Date:  10-27-2013
Number of Hours:  2.50
Manual Reference:  8-5
Brief Description:  Modified Seat Ribs

I didn't get much done on the plane this weekend. I had our camper serviced and purchased a generator (never too early to prepare for Sun N Fun). I took Ginger flying for the first time in months and when we got back, I began working on the seat ribs. It was while countersinking the holes for the platenuts that I discovered that my new drill bit was a #41 and not a #40. I think I will have to redrill the entire aft fuselage as the rivets would not fit the holes. I'm glad that I never dissasembled it for dimpling. The ribs however, are edge finished and ready to be clecoed to the bulkheads. I still haven't made it back to the longerons yet!
